WebFeb 2, 2024 · Invalidity The concept that an inconsistent law will be invalidated through the operation of s 109 does not mean that the law is void ab initio: Carter v Egg and Egg Pulp Marketing Board (Victoria) (1942) 66 CLR 557 .The High Court has held that “invalid” means that the law is “suspended, inoperative and ineffective”: Butler v Attorney ... WebInconsistent Speech Disorder 10% (0.6% pop) Inconsistent production of >40% based on three elicitations of the same lexical items in the same phonetic context. Indicated Intervention: Whole word (core vocabulary) Childhood Apraxia of Speech Rare (up to 1 in 1000) Lifelong disorder. Consonants and vowels equally effected.
